Tonix Pharma Reports First Quarter 2017 Financial Results And Provides Programs Update

NEW YORK, May 15, 2017 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Tonix Pharmaceuticals Holding Corp. (Nasdaq:TNXP) (Tonix), a company that is developing innovative pharmaceutical products to address public health challenges, recently announced financial results for the first quarter ended March 31, 2017.

“Beginning enrollment in the first quarter of 2017 of the Phase 3 HONOR study of TNX-102 SL* for the treatment of posttraumatic stress disorder (PTSD) was an important milestone for Tonix,” said Seth Lederman, M.D., president and chief executive officer of Tonix. “We remain on track with our previously-disclosed guidance for reporting results next year, and are pleased to note that this pivotal study is fully funded through completion. If the topline data from the HONOR study are statistically persuasive, we can file a new drug application with the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) seeking approval for TNX-102 SL for PTSD. PTSD affects approximately 8.6 million Americans, nearly 1 million of whom are military veterans. Patients with military-related PTSD experience severe symptoms, and currently-approved drugs have not shown efficacy in these patients, creating an urgent need for a new therapeutic approach.”
